Lynnette Bower, a proud native of the Mendocino coast, serves as the co-manager of the CNPS Nursery and holds the position of nursery co-chair for the Milo Baker CNPS chapter. Specializing in propagating and facilitating nursery stock for local CNPS plant sales, Lynnette brings her passion for plants to the heart of the California Native Seed Project. With a rich background in horticulture, she has dedicated her expertise to various esteemed organizations, including Cal Flora nursery, LandPaths, and Point Reyes National Seashore. Lynnette is not only a lifelong learner, having earned two associates degrees from SRJC, but she also continues her educational journey as a current student at Sonoma State.

Local ecotypes of seeds are important for several reasons, primarily related to their adaptation to specific local environmental conditions. Here are some key reasons why local ecotypes are valued:
- Adaptation to Local Conditions:
Local ecotypes have evolved over time to thrive in the specific climate, soil, and other environmental conditions of a particular region. As a result, they are often better adapted to local challenges such as temperature extremes, precipitation patterns, and soil types. - Biodiversity Conservation:
Utilizing local ecotypes helps preserve and promote biodiversity. Each local ecotype may represent a unique set of genetic traits that contribute to the overall diversity of plant species. Preserving these diverse genetic resources is essential for the resilience of ecosystems and the ability of plants to adapt to changing environmental conditions. - Ecosystem Restoration:
When undertaking ecological restoration projects, using local ecotypes is crucial for the successful re-establishment of native vegetation. These plants are more likely to survive and reproduce, enhancing the restoration efforts and promoting the recovery of natural ecosystems. - Resilience to Climate Change:
As climate change leads to shifts in temperature, precipitation, and other environmental factors, local ecotypes may have a better chance of withstanding these changes due to their adaptation to specific local conditions. Using locally adapted seeds can contribute to the resilience of plant species in the face of climate change. - Cultural and Ethical Considerations:
Local ecotypes are often tied to the cultural identity of a region. Many indigenous communities have cultivated and relied on specific plant varieties for generations. Preserving and using local seeds respects the cultural heritage and traditional knowledge associated with these plants. - Reduced Dependency on External Inputs:
Local ecotypes are accustomed to the pests and diseases prevalent in their specific region. Using these seeds may reduce the need for external inputs such as pesticides and fertilizers, as these plants have already developed natural defenses against local threats. - Economic Benefits:
Local ecotypes can contribute to sustainable agriculture and local economies. Farmers using seeds adapted to their region may experience higher yields and incur fewer production costs, ultimately supporting the economic viability of agriculture in the area. - Seed Sovereignty:
Utilizing local ecotypes supports the concept of seed sovereignty, emphasizing the rights of communities to control their own seed resources. This can be particularly important in the face of commercial seed production and distribution that may not always prioritize local needs and sustainability.
